When the Washington Post discovered Bob McDonnell's blueprint for governing, they didn't just find an academic paper. They found "a vision that he started to put into action soon after he was elected to the Virginia House of Delegates."Bob McDonnell legislated on these ideas for 14 years in the General Assembly. He opposed efforts to improve our childcare centers in 2001 and 2003, and even voted against eliminating gender-based wage discrimination. That's right -- he even voted against a woman's right to equal pay.
He sponsored not one, not two, but 35 bills restricting a woman's right to choose even in the cases of rape and incest.
On many of these issues, he worked hand-in-hand with his running mate, current Lieutenant Governor Bill Bolling.
